data:image/s3,"s3://crabby-images/10e6e/10e6e3eab3c17cfcc37f0dc59c34652f74716edf" alt="Adobe COLDFUSION 9 Скачать руководство пользователя страница 1048"
1043
DEVELOPING
COLDFUSION 9 APPLICATIONS
Working with Documents, Charts, and Reports
Las
t
upda
te
d 8/5/2010
3
Click the Next button. Then click the Add button:
a
In the Series Label field, type
Total Sales
.
b
In the Paint Style field, choose Light.
c
In the Data Label field, choose Value.
d
In the Color List, type
Teal,Gray
.
e
In the Chart Data Source area, ensure that the Data From A Fixed List of Values option is selected.
4
Click the Add button:
a
In the Label field, type
Sold
.
b
In the Value field, choose #calc.Sold# from pop-up menu.
c
Click OK.
5
Click the Add button again:
a
In the Label field, type
Unsold
.
b
In the Value field, choose #calc.Unsold# from the pop-up menu.
c
Click OK twice to return to the Chart Series dialog box.
6
Click the Next button. In the Chart Formatting dialog box, click the Titles & Series tab and make the following
changes:
a
In the Chart Title field, type
Total Sales
for #query.LASTNAME#.
b
In the X Axis Title field, type
Sold
.
c
In the Y Axis Title field, type
Unsold
.
d
In the Label Format field, choose Currency from the pop-up menu.
e
Click the 3-D Appearance tab and ensure that Show 3-D is selected.
7
Click the Font tab and make the following changes:
a
Change the Font Name to Arial.
b
Change the Font Size to 9.
8
Click the Finish button. Report Builder adds a place holder for the pie chart in the report.
9
Resize and move the chart to the desired location within the LASTNAME Footer band.
10
Choose File > Save to save your changes to the report.
11
Press F12 to preview the report.
Add a pie chart to the report footer
1
Create two calculated fields to use in the report footer pie chart with the following parameters:
Name
TotalSold
TotalUnsold
Default Label Text:
Total Sold
Total Unsold
Data Type:
Big Decimal
Big Decimal
Calculation:
Sum
Sum
Perform Calculation On:
Iif(IsBoolean(query.ISSOLD) and
query.ISSOLD, query.Price,0)
Iif(IsBoolean(query.ISSOLD) and
not(query.ISSOLD), query.Price,0)
Содержание COLDFUSION 9
Страница 1: ...Developing Applications ADOBE COLDFUSION 9...